I modded my first Poison tail so i could have larger heavy duty hooks and a screw lock trailer keeper. This one now does spinnerbaits and buzzbaits. From 2 moddified Poison tail molds i can now make flipping jigs, swim jigs, bladed jigs, spinnerbaits, and buzzbaits. I hope to have some videos tomorrow of the spinnerbait and buzzbait.
